Anti-wear

PA. Technologies refers to your process conditions to determine the correct material for the right application. In the field of wear, we put forth the Densit® concrete whose wide range of coating has proven its quality for more than 30 years,. It is mostly used in coatings of separators, cyclones, crushers, dragging chains and all types of ducts. Moreover, Densit® coated pipes are also applied in the context of pneumatic transport in particular. Therefore, we also propose the ceramic-based solutions for applications and conditions of specific processes and for a severe wear.
